This is my first time building my own rig, it'll be for gaming and video editing mostly, i was wondering if all of these components and the case work fine together?
I'm from the UK and probably be buying my components from novatech.
My budget is around £700.
I'll most likely settle with a 1080p monitor, and i'm not planning for sli; However i'm upping the psu so i can get a gtx 680 or 780 when they drop in price.
Any suggestions or constructive criticisms are appreciated.

Case:NZXT Guardian 921
PSU:Corsair Gaming Series GS700 - 700W
Motherboard:MSI H61M-P31 [1155]
Processor:3rd Gen I5 3570K 3.40GHZ
Ram:Novatech 8GB (1x8GB) 1333 DDR3
Graphics:GeForce GTX 560 Ti
Cooling:CoolerMaster HYPER 212 Evo
